Souave Readying for Mixed-Use Elton Park in Detroit

Souave Enterprises LLC is preparing to launch construction on its mixed-use development in Detroit’s Corktown neighborhood. Dubbed Elton Park, the project will offer more than 400 apartments and thousands of square feet of retail space within a five-block area.

The first $43.8-million phase will have 150 apartments and some retail on the ground floor. Construction should begin in spring of next year, with completion set for December 2018. Part of the first phase will include a rehab of the Checker Cab building at 2128 Trumbull.

All four project phases are anticipated to cost approximately $125 million. Construction details on the next three phases have not been released. Corktown is an historic district, just west of Detroit’s CBD.
